The Formula
The underlying logic of the calculator is based on a straightforward summation of all input costs, represented as:
totalCost = rawMaterialCost + laborCost + utilityCost + overheadCost
This formula aggregates the various cost components to present a comprehensive view of the financial implications associated with your chemical process. It allows for quick adjustments and recalculations as you refine your estimates or consider alternative scenarios.
π‘ Industry Pro Tip
When estimating costs, don't forget to account for potential fluctuations in raw material prices and labor rates. It's wise to include a contingency factor in your calculations, ideally around 10-15%, to mitigate the impact of unforeseen changes in costs. This foresight can help you avoid budget overruns and ensure that your project remains financially viable.
